What heat plausibly does for sore muscles

The most well-established effect of a sauna session is increased blood flow. Heat causes blood vessels near the skin and in working tissue to widen, moving more blood through muscles that may be tight or fatigued from training. More blood flow generally means more delivery of oxygen and nutrients to tissue and, in principle, better clearance of metabolic byproducts, which is the physiological basis for why heat is thought to help with recovery and soreness.

Heat also has a direct effect on muscle tissue itself: warmth tends to make muscles feel looser and more pliable, which is part of why a hot room feels so good after a hard lower-body or full-body session. Combined with the general relaxation of sitting quietly in a warm space, many people report feeling less sore and more loose after a sauna session than before it.

It is important to be honest about the strength of the underlying research here. Small studies have looked at heat exposure and markers of muscle recovery with some encouraging results, but the body of evidence is nowhere near as deep as it is for basics like sleep, protein intake and progressive training load. The fair framing is plausible and worth trying, not a proven performance intervention.

Why heat does not carry cold’s specific concern

This is where sauna and cold plunge genuinely diverge, and it is worth spelling out clearly. Cold exposure immediately after strength training has been studied for possibly interfering with some of the cellular signaling that drives muscle growth, which is why several of our cold plunge guides recommend spacing cold sessions away from lifting if building muscle is a priority — see our cold plunge and muscle growth guide for the detail.

Heat does not raise that same specific concern. There is no comparable body of research suggesting a sauna session dampens the adaptations you are training for, which is part of why heat is generally considered the more flexible tool to use close to a workout. That does not mean heat is proven to help muscle growth directly — it means it is not fighting against it the way cold potentially can, which makes it a lower-stakes choice if your priority is recovery comfort rather than a specific training goal.

Timing a session around your training

For most people, a sauna session after training is the more comfortable and more common choice. By the time a workout is finished, you have already done the hard work, and using the sauna as a wind-down lets you relax into the heat rather than adding a demanding session on top of one you have not yet started. Give yourself a few minutes to cool down and take in some fluids before stepping into the heat, since going in already dehydrated and overheated from training stacks two demanding things at once.

A brief, gentle sauna session before training is possible and some people use it as a way to loosen up, but it is not where the plausible recovery benefit lives, and a long or very hot pre-workout session risks leaving you fatigued and dehydrated before you have even started. If you want to use heat before training, keep it short and mild, and treat it as a warm-up preference rather than a performance necessity.

What heat does not do

It is worth debunking a couple of persistent myths directly. Sweating in a sauna does not flush lactic acid out of your muscles. Lactic acid is cleared from muscle tissue through ordinary metabolism within roughly an hour after exercise, well before delayed-onset soreness typically shows up a day or two later, so it is simply not present in the muscle by the time a post-workout sauna session would act on it. Whatever relief you feel comes from blood flow and relaxation, not from sweating a substance out.

  • A sauna will not repair muscle tissue faster than your body’s own repair processes, which depend heavily on sleep and adequate protein.
  • A sauna is not a substitute for a proper warm-up or cool-down routine around lifting.
  • A sauna session does not detoxify your body or remove toxins through sweat, a claim we take apart fully in our sauna detox guide.

Setting expectations honestly matters here, because overselling heat as a shortcut can lead people to skip the recovery basics that actually matter most.

Using a sauna for recovery safely

Because a workout already places real demand on your cardiovascular system and your fluid balance, treat a post-training sauna session with the same care you would any other session: rehydrate before you go in, keep the session at a comfortable length rather than your longest, and get out if you feel lightheaded, nauseous or unusually fatigued. Training and heat both ask something of your body, and stacking them without attention to hydration is where most sauna problems after exercise come from.

Anyone with a heart condition, uncontrolled blood pressure, or other reasons a doctor has flagged heat exposure as a concern should check in before adding sauna sessions to a training routine, regardless of how mild the recovery claims sound. Frequently asked questions

Does a sauna actually help sore muscles recover faster?

The evidence is limited but plausible, not proven. Heat increases blood flow and tends to feel genuinely soothing on tight or sore muscles, and some smaller studies suggest a possible role in recovery, but the research base is thinner than for cold exposure or basic recovery habits like sleep and protein intake. Treat it as a likely helpful, comfortable habit rather than a proven performance tool.

Is sauna better than a cold plunge for muscle recovery?

They work differently rather than one being simply better. Cold exposure right after strength training has been studied for possibly blunting some of the muscle-building adaptations you are training for, while heat does not carry that same specific concern. For general soreness and relaxation, either can help; for maximizing muscle growth after lifting, timing matters more for cold than for heat.

Should I use a sauna before or after a workout?

After is generally the more common and comfortable choice, once you have cooled down and rehydrated a little, since going in already fatigued and dehydrated from training adds real load on top of load. A brief, gentle warm-up sauna before a workout is possible for some people, but it is not necessary and is not where most of the plausible recovery benefit lives.

Can a sauna replace stretching, sleep or protein for recovery?

No. Sleep, adequate protein and progressive training load have far stronger evidence behind them for muscle recovery than sauna use does. A sauna session is a pleasant addition on top of those fundamentals, not a substitute for any of them.

Does sweating in a sauna help flush lactic acid or soreness out of muscles?

No, and this is a common myth. Lactic acid clears from muscles through normal metabolism within roughly an hour of exercise, long before soreness sets in, and sweating does not accelerate that process or drain soreness out of tissue. Any relief you feel from heat comes from increased blood flow and relaxation, not from sweating anything out.

Is it safe to use a sauna on a rest day with no workout?

For most healthy adults, yes, and many people find it a pleasant, low-key way to relax on a day off training. As with any session, stay well hydrated, keep it comfortable rather than pushed, and anyone with a heart condition or other health concern should check with a doctor first.
